Why Workout With Weights?
Middle-aged women who have never before lifted weights can derive enormous benefits from following a well-planned resistance training program. Menopause can be a challenging time, with fluctuating hormones causing irritability, tiredness, headaches, hot flushes and mood swings long before a woman finally reaches the end of her reproductive years. You can't prevent your menopause, so you may as well learn to manage it, and embrace the changes that are going to take place whether you like it or not.
Sadly, peri-menopausal women are likely to lose around 200 grams of muscle mass each year, (around 3% to 5% per decade). Whilst muscle does not 'turn to fat' we do tend to gain fat because our reduced muscle mass cannot burn all the calories we consume if we do not adjust our diet. After age 50 we are destined to lose 1% - 2% of our muscle mass per year, and unless we take active steps to re-build muscle we face a depressing spiral of weight gain and weakness. |
So now the GOOD news:
You CAN take steps to improve your strength, improve your balance and manage your moods.
Women in their peri-menopause and menopausal years tend to drop regular exercise just at the very time when it is most important for them to consider their own needs. Undertaking a properly designed strength-training program will help you to maintain your muscle. Stronger muscles lead to stronger bones, better posture, better balance, and a higher overall metabolism. Read more under The Tabs relating to Your Trainer; The Program; and When, Where & How Much.
